🌶 Daily highlight 🌶

Plaid unveiled Beacon, a collaborative fraud intelligence network. Fintechs must pay Plaid to signup to the network, and will contribute by reporting fraud instances to Plaid. Members can then screen new users against the Beacon network to see if the user has committed fraud on another platform 🎯

Asking companies to contribute sensitive first-party data while making them pay for the privilege seems rich, but Plaid may be able to pull it off. Plaid’s bet is that companies will make the trade in order to reduce operational costs associated with KYC, AML and fraud. Time will tell if they’re right ⌛
